Abstract
The hexadentate Schiff base ligands were prepared by condensation of 3-ethoxy-2-hydroxybenzaldehyde and different diamines (1,3-diaminopropane, 1,3-diamino-2,2-dimethylpropane, 1,4-diaminobutane) to yield H2Ln (H2L1, H2L2 and H2L3, respectively). The ligands have been characterised by elemental analysis, IR, 1H and 13C NMR spectroscopies and mass spectrometry (ES). The crystal structure of the H2L2 ligand was solved by X-ray crystallography, revealing its ability to bind metal centres.
